![](/img/trans.png)
[英]Check MS Office license status via Office Automation or with other way
[英]Is there a way to automate MS Office applications without license?
我目前正在写,这将在Excel中进行自动化的应用程序。 我在工作计算机上安装了MS Office(2007),并且该应用程序运行正常,但引用了Microsoft Excel 12.0 Object Lirary。
目标计算机已安装Office,但尚未注册。 它是那些预装的版本之一。 尝试在目标计算机上运行该应用程序时出现错误,提示未安装Office?
我假设您必须拥有注册的Office才能使用对象库? 我周围没有Office许可证密钥,而且价格相当昂贵,是否有解决方法?
查看是否可以在该计算机上手动运行Excel。 如果可以这样做,那么您也应该能够使其自动化。 如果不能,请不要指望能够奇迹般地(合法地)使其通过自动化工作。 通过其对象库自动执行Office与通过UI进行自动化没有什么不同。 您需要具有Office的许可且已正确安装,才能使用它。
当前的许可指南禁止在服务器上使用Office应用程序来满足客户端请求, 除非这些客户端本身已获得Office的许可副本
您正在尝试实现自动化/实现什么? 您不认为OpenOffice有用吗?
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.